On 08/10/2016 23:57, Rudolf Marek wrote:
I did the HPET NMI generator on Intel PCH, it works fine. I just fill the MSI addr/data in a way that it was delivering NMI to certain CPU - physical delivery to a CPU with a certain ID.
If this does not work on AMD, perhaps there is some problem with chipset configuration. Please check the HT specs and try to sort out the MT3 setup.
I've just got this working on my AMD hardware too. I had to use the same HT encoding for the Delivery Mode / Message Type bits as with IO-APIC.